Abstract

We study preservation properties of relatively star-Hurewicz property under two mappings and in Alexandroff space. For a topological space X, the collection of relatively star-Hurewicz subspaces of X is an admissible $$\sigma$$ -ideal in X. The characterizations of relatively star-Hurewicz spaces given using selection principles. For a paracompact space X, TWO has a winning strategy in the star-Hurewicz game on X if and only if TWO has a winning strategy in the Hurewicz game on X. In this manner we obtain relationships of relatively star-Hurewicz property with other existing Hurewicz properties in literature.
